Federal Member for Perth Patrick Gorman has avoided questions about whether he's advocating for more aged care funding for Western Australia after pointed calls from the premier. Aged care providers say more beds are urgently needed to take pressure off EDs amid unprecedented demand on hospitals this week.

01:25The Premier will lobby the Albanese government for more aged care funding when he's in Canberra next week.
01:31Likely highlighting the current strain on WA's hospitals that's fuelling an elective surgery backlog.
01:39The health department confirmed a further 27 elective surgeries were rescheduled today after around 25 yesterday and 80 the day before.
